Biodiversity The variety of organisms considered at all levels from populations to ecosystems.
Taxonomy The science of describing, naming, and classifying organisms.
Taxon Any particular group within a taxonomic system.
Kingdom The largest category which consist of animals and plants.
Domain Categories above the kingdoms which consist of plants, animals, bacteria, archaea, protists and fungi.
Phylum Category below Kingdom.
Division In a traditional taxonomic system for plants, the category contained with in a kingdom and containing classes.
Class Category below Phylum.
Order Category below Class
Family Category below Order.
Genus Category below Family
Species Smallest grouping, which contains only a single kind of organism.
Binomial Nomenclature A system for giving each organism a two-word scientific name that consists of the genus name followed by the species name.
Subspecies Variations of a species that live in different geographic areas.
Taxa Plural form of Taxon.
Carolus Linnaeus Swedish naturalist who devised a system of grouping organisms into hierarchical categories according to their form and structure.
